Student life is a unique experience that comes with its own set of challenges and opportunities. As a student, you h-e the chance to explore new subjects, meet new people, and develop valuable skills that will serve you well in the future. However, being a student can also be stressful and overwhelming at times, especially when you're juggling multiple classes, assignments, and extracurricular activities. In this article, we'll explore some tips and strategies for making the most of your student experience and achieving success both academically and personally.

- Set Goals and Prioritize

One of the most important things you can do as a student is to set clear goals for yourself and prioritize your time accordingly. This means taking the time to think about what you want to achieve in each of your classes, as well as in your personal life. Once you h-e a clear idea of your goals, you can create a plan for achieving them and start to prioritize your time accordingly. This might mean setting aside specific times for studying, attending classes, and completing assignments, as well as making time for socializing, exercise, and other activities that are important to you.

- Stay Organized

Being a successful student also requires staying organized and keeping track of all of your assignments, deadlines, and other important information. This means using a planner or calendar to keep track of your schedule, as well as creating a system for organizing your notes and other materials. You might also consider using digital tools like Google Drive or Evernote to keep track of your assignments and notes, or using apps like Trello or Asana to manage your to-do list and stay on top of your tasks.

- Ask for Help

No matter how well-prepared you are, there will be times when you need help or support as a student. Whether you're struggling with a particular assignment, feeling overwhelmed by your workload, or just need someone to talk to, it's important to reach out and ask for help when you need it. This might mean talking to your professors or academic advisors, seeking out tutoring or other academic support services, or connecting with a peer mentor or counselor. By asking for help when you need it, you'll be better equipped to overcome challenges and achieve your goals as a student.

- Get Involved

Another key to success as a student is getting involved in your school community and taking advantage of the many opportunities -ailable to you. This might mean joining clubs or organizations that align with your interests, attending campus events and lectures, or volunteering in your local community. By getting involved, you'll not only h-e the chance to meet new people and explore new interests, but you'll also develop valuable skills like leadership, teamwork, and communication.

- Take Care of Yourself

Finally, it's important to remember that being a successful student also requires taking care of yourself both physically and mentally. This means making time for exercise, getting enough sleep, and eating a healthy diet, as well as taking steps to manage stress and prioritize self-care. Whether it's practicing mindfulness, taking a yoga class, or simply taking a break to read a book or watch a movie, make sure to prioritize your well-being as a student.

In conclusion, being a successful student requires a combination of hard work, dedication, and self-care. By setting clear goals, staying organized, asking for help when you need it, getting involved in your school community, and taking care of yourself, you'll be well on your way to achieving success both academically and personally.
